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: ASA physical status I–II patients undergoing renal surgery.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Body mass index exceeding 25 kg/m2 or less than 19 kg/m2, renal or hepatic insufficiency, known allergy to Levobupivacaine, neurological or psychiatric diseases, therapy with anticoagulant or sedative drugs.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
perioperative blood pressure;perioperative heart rate;Onset time of sensory block;Duration of sensory block;the rate of motor block;The effect of muscle relaxation;perioperative sedation score;postoperative pain score;The first exhaust time;The incidence of postoperative shiverin;
